Tokyo - Asakusa - Tokyo
In the morning, upon our arrival in Tokyo, we meet our local guide and vehicle waiting for us at the airport and head toward the city center. It won’t take long before we begin to feel the energy of this fascinating city! Our first stop is Asakusa / Senso-ji Temple, which best reflects Tokyo’s traditional spirit. Built in 645 and famous for its enormous red lanterns, this Shinto temple, one of Japan’s oldest and most visited sacred sites, invites us into the mystical atmosphere of the past. Right in front of the temple, we step into a time journey along Nakamise, Japan’s first open-air shopping street. Here, in more than 70 authentic shops lined up one after another, we will have the opportunity to discover many things, from Japanese handicrafts and traditional clothing to local snacks and unique souvenirs. If you wish, you can taste local street foods and pick up little surprises for your loved ones. At the end of our tour, we head to the Ginza district, one of the country’s most prestigious shopping and fashion streets, to discover Tokyo’s modern side. With its modern architecture, luxury boutiques, stylish cafés, and vibrant atmosphere on the streets, Ginza offers both the elegance and dynamism of Tokyo. After the tour, we transfer to our hotel and rest for our first night in Tokyo. Overnight at our hotel.

Tokyo
After breakfast at our hotel, we head into the heart of Tokyo to begin experiencing the city like the locals do. Today, we explore the city using the Tokyo Metro, one of the world’s most advanced public transportation networks. With 304 kilometers of track length, 13 different lines, and a total of 285 stations, the Tokyo Metro offers us a practical and enjoyable way to discover the many faces of this vast metropolis. Our first stop is Tsukiji Fish Market, Japan’s oldest and most traditional fish market. Here, we dive into the heart of Japanese cuisine and explore Tokyo’s authentic side as we wander among fresh seafood. Next, we head to Akihabara, Japan’s center of technology and pop culture. Packed with colorful electronics stores, anime figures, and all things digital, this district is a paradise for tech enthusiasts. Our tour continues with the famous Hachiko Statue, which has won the hearts of the Japanese people with its loyalty. Right next to it, we experience the Shibuya Scramble Crossing, one of the busiest intersections in the world, crossed by approximately 1 million people a day—just watching this chaotic yet orderly flow is an experience in itself! Afterwards, we step into Tokyo’s fashion world. The colorful street style of Harajuku and Omotesando Avenue, home to Japan’s visionary designers and known for its elegant boutiques, are among today’s final stops. At the end of the day, we return to our hotel and continue our stay in Tokyo. This unique city, where modernity blends with tradition, will generously show us different sides of itself today. Osaka - Tokyo
After breakfast at our hotel, we will embark on our enchanting Nikko tour. Nikko, which is on the UNESCO World Heritage List and stands out as one of Japan’s most impressive regions for its natural beauty, welcomes us with its magnificent scenery and historic structures. We begin our tour with a short stroll around Lake Chuzenji, known for its striking mountain views and peaceful atmosphere. Next, we visit Kegon Falls, one of Japan’s most beautiful natural wonders, formed by the waters flowing down from the lake. Later in the day, we explore Toshogu Shrine, which fascinates visitors with its architecture and symbols. Built with the craftsmanship of approximately 15,000 artisans, this shrine draws attention not only for its architectural richness but also for the famous three monkey figures on its inner walls, conveying the message “See no evil, hear no evil, speak no evil.” At the end of the tour, we return to Tokyo and check into our hotel.
